Understanding the CNC Bridgeport Milling Machine

If you're wondering why you should consider a CNC Bridgeport Milling machine,the simple answer lies in its features. CNC Bridgeport Milling machines stand out for their robust design,longevity,and precision. The machines– core parts include a column,spindle,knee,saddle,table,and an arbor,which work together to deliver precision in each operation.

The spindle accommodates various cutting tools and can move along different axes,making it ideal for complex drilling and cutting jobs. The knee holds and moves the arbor,while the saddle and table hold the workpiece securely in place during operation. These components' collaborative working further solidifies the machine's accuracy and efficiency.

Factors to Consider when Buying a CNC Bridgeport Milling Machine

Though investing in a CNC Bridgeport Milling machine could significantly streamline your manufacturing process,certain factors need to be in mind. They include:

Operation complexity:The more complex operations you need to perform,the more likely it is you'll need a high-end CNC Milling machine that can accommodate multiple axes.

Materials:Your intended raw material for milling also impacts your machine choice. Different models handle different materials,varying from metal to wood then plastic. Ensure to choose a machine that fits your material type.

Space:While assessing the machine–s functionality is essential,don't overlook the infrastructure necessary to accommodate this equipment. Considering the space you have available is crucial to make the installation process hassle-free.

Pre-Owned Vs. New Machines

If the cost of a new CNC Bridgeport Milling machine is too much to bear,consider exploring the used machine market. You can often find high-quality,pre-owned CNC Bridgeport Milling machines at significantly lower prices. The vital point when buying used machines is ensuring the equipment is in good working condition. Strive to buy from a reputable seller,preferably one that offers after-sale service and,if possible,a warranty on the machine. This practice affords you some level of protection if issues arise after purchasing.
